concave 凹状

con-, 强调。-cave, 洞穴。洞穴状的,凹进去的。

concave (adj.)
early 15c., from Old French concave (14c.) or directly from Latin concavus "hollow, arched, vaulted, curved," from com-, intensive prefix (see com-), + cavus "hollow" (see cave (n.)).
